As Toyah sparked it, we shall kick off with the news that The legendary Toyah Willcox and Robert Fripp have confirmed they are performing live in summer 2023 at the legendary Cropredy Convention.

For being in her mid 60s she looks pretty Sensational.

Tune 1 Toyah ft Robert Fripp - Sensational (Posh Redux)

You might have heard of Robert Fripp, as he has been aroundfor donkeys ages and pretty instrumental to many musicians, and he married Toyah Willcox years ago.

It is great seeing them going strong, and on her website Toyah was talking walking about how they sat down on Christmas Day and planned the next three years, which includes two albums and tours. Pretty good going when you are almost 70.

She is unmistakably Toyah but much more refined that songs from last century.
